What is the process for new car registration and mortgage loan?

First, the borrower should submit the loan application materials to the bank. The bank will conduct a preliminary review of the application materials submitted by the borrower. If the bank's initial review and credit investigation are passed, the loan application will be approved. After the customer's qualifications and materials are approved, the contract can be signed, and procedures such as mortgage registration and insurance can be completed. Generally, the bank will disburse the loan within 2 to 3 weeks or 1 month after the approval process is completed, with the fastest disbursement possible in 1 day.

The process of new car registration and mortgage pledge, from the perspective of an auto salesperson, starts with selecting a vehicle. After helping the customer place an order and signing the contract, I guide them through applying for a mortgage loan. They need to prepare their ID card, income proof, and bank statements for bank approval, which usually takes one or two days. Once the bank approves, the loan contract is signed, and the car serves as collateral. Next, insurance must be purchased, including compulsory traffic insurance and commercial insurance, to proceed with the mortgage registration and license plate application at the DMV. Before registration, the purchase tax must be paid, followed by a vehicle inspection and license plate selection. Finally, the license plate is installed to complete the process, which typically takes about a week. As a dealer, we usually coordinate with the bank and DMV to make the process smoother for the customer.

Where is the OBD interface of the Dongfeng Peugeot 2008 located?

Peugeot 2008's computer connection port is the OBD interface, located inside the cover panel under the steering wheel. Start from the top and pull the cover panel off with force to see the black and green OBD interface. Below is an introduction to OBD: 1. The OBD system continuously monitors the engine's operating conditions to check if the vehicle's exhaust exceeds standards. If it does, a warning will be issued immediately. When a system failure occurs, the malfunction indicator lamp or check engine warning light will illuminate, and the Powertrain Control Module (PCM) will store the fault information in memory. 2. Through a certain procedure, the fault codes can be read from the PCM. Based on the fault codes, maintenance personnel can quickly and accurately determine the nature and location of the fault.

Where is the carbon canister solenoid valve located on the Roewe 550?

Roewe 550 carbon canister solenoid valve is located in the engine compartment of the vehicle. Here are specific details about the carbon canister solenoid valve: Function: The carbon canister solenoid valve serves to reduce air pollution caused by fuel vapor emissions while improving fuel efficiency. When the engine is turned off, the carbon canister begins absorbing fuel vapors evaporating from the fuel tank, trapping them firmly within the activated carbon micropores inside the canister to prevent vapor release into the atmosphere. Effects of damage: If the carbon canister solenoid valve is damaged, it may cause insufficient engine power. Installation location: The carbon canister is installed between the fuel tank and the engine. Since gasoline is a highly volatile liquid, the fuel tank often contains vapors at normal temperatures. The fuel evaporation emission control system is designed to direct these vapors into combustion and prevent their release into the atmosphere.

How Many Points Are Deducted for Driving in the Wrong Lane?

Driving a motor vehicle in a non-compliant lane generally refers to not driving in the designated lane, straddling or crossing lane markings. There are three types of violations: 1. Expressway: Driving a motor vehicle on an expressway without following the designated lane, violation code: 43120, penalty standard: 3-point deduction and a fine. 2. Urban expressway: Driving a motor vehicle on an urban expressway without following the designated lane, violation code: 13550, penalty standard: 3-point deduction and a fine. 3. Non-expressway roads: Driving a motor vehicle on roads other than expressways or urban expressways without following the designated lane, violation code: 60230, penalty standard: No point deduction, only a fine.

What are the differences between engines of domestic cars and joint-venture cars?

Domestic cars and joint-venture cars differ in engine quality, which is indeed a significant distinction between them. In the joint-venture car market, whether it's Japanese brands like Toyota and Honda, German brands like Volkswagen and BMW, or Korean brands like Hyundai and Kia, these companies have a relatively long history and strong engine technology. The annual 'Top 10 Engines' are mostly produced by these companies. More information about domestic engines is as follows: 1. Chinese manufacturers can produce excellent engines, but due to factors such as design, equipment, and materials, there is still a gap compared to the world's top standards. Therefore, there is still a considerable distance to fully independently design and manufacture outstanding engines. 2. China's automotive industry started late, and many companies initially relied on purchasing and reverse-engineering well-known, high-quality engines for their own design and development.
